Luks is a modern variant derived from the Latin name 'Lucas,' meaning 'light' or 'illumination.' Historically, Lucas was associated with the evangelist Saint Luke, symbolizing enlightenment and guidance. The name carries connotations of clarity, vision, and brightness, reflecting a legacy of knowledge and inspiration.
The name Luks, rooted in Latin tradition, is a modern take on Lucas, a name with deep biblical and cultural roots. Saint Luke, one of the four Evangelists, brought a lasting spiritual and scholarly significance to the name. Across Europe, variations of Lucas have been popular for centuries, symbolizing light, knowledge, and guidance.
